{"data":{"id":"us-vt/14-v.s.a.-2685","jurisdiction":"us-vt","citation":"14 V.S.A. § 2685","heading":"Decree; appeal","body":"On hearing the parties interested, the court shall make decree in the premises as appears just. The person complained of may appeal from such decree without giving bond, but during the pendency thereof, the person so appointed shall act as guardian.","path":["Title 14: Decedents Estates and Fiduciary Relations","Chapter 111: Guardianship","Subchapter 002: PERSONS FOR WHOM GUARDIANS APPOINTED"],"source_url":"https://legislature.vermont.gov/statutes/section/14/111/02685","current_through":"2025 session","vintage":"","retrieved_at":"2026-09-05T17:16:59Z","sha256":"abc5b771e531d311cd2f3938b2c9f2f304233a563eaef2f8c5b2c8e4a5b0bdc0","source_id":"us-vt","stale":false,"prev":"us-vt/14-v.s.a.-2684","next":"us-vt/14-v.s.a.-2686"},"notice":"GroundRules: Original legal text.
